Transaction 4260586612b909c30de925fb17dc093a00d96f49e1602c2fd32c8635e0908189
1 Input
1 Output
-
4260586612b909c30de925fb17dc093a00d96f49e1602c2fd32c8635e0908189:0
- value
- 1522696
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6d364cd6a6034ab05cb840ef9e6156b194038fa6 OP_EQUAL
- address
- 3BeUdHzmv8286uvTYtr1wohTSgKmfWCnSb